Ver Mensaje Individual
  #3 (permalink)  
Antiguo 23/11/2010, 15:22
Avatar de Monimo
Monimo
 
Fecha de Ingreso: noviembre-2007
Ubicación: Mexico Df
Mensajes: 742
Antigüedad: 17 años, 1 mes
Puntos: 69
Respuesta: consulta sql sencilla

Pues suena lógico no? Lo que entiendo de tu consulta es:

SELECT id FROM tabla WHERE id<$id AND activo=1 limit 1

Me va regresar un solo resultado, siempre y cuando el id "dinámico" o variable , sea mayor...que los ids que tengas en la tabla. Lo que me pone a pensar, no importa cuantos o cuales ids yo evalue, si evaluo el 1234 por ejemplo, el 1 será menor a este id, y será el primero que encuentre. Solo NO te regresaría el 1 si el id que evalúes es 0 o algun número negativo no?
__________________
La verdad es que lo que no quisiera dejar de hacer nunca (a parte de comer) es programar